Consistency of left ventricular hypertrophy diagnosed by electrocardiography and echocardiography: the Northern Shanghai Study.

机构信息

Department of Cardiology, Shanghai Tenth People's Hospital, School of Medicine, Tongji University, Shanghai, People's Republic of China,

Department of Prevention, School of Medicine, Tongji University, Shanghai, People's Republic of China.

出版信息

Clin Interv Aging. 2019 Mar 11;14:549-556. doi: 10.2147/CIA.S180723. eCollection 2019.

DOI:10.2147/CIA.S180723
PMID:30880935
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C6417007/
Abstract

BACKGROUND

Left ventricular hypertrophy (LVH) is one of the preclinical manifestations of hypertensive target organ damage (TOD). However, it remains unclear which electrocardiographic criterion perform better in diagnosing LVH.

PURPOSE

To investigate the consistency of LVH diagnosed by electrocardiography (ECG) and echocardiography (ECHO). Taking LVH by ECHO as reference, to compare three different ECG criteria (Sokolow-Lyon, Cornell and Cornell Product criteria) and find the best ECG indicator for identifying LVH in community-based elderly Chinese.

PATIENTS AND METHODS

Echocardiography and electrocardiography were applied to define LVH in 1789 elderly Chinese aged >65 years old in communities located at the northern Shanghai. Echocardiographic LVH (ECHO-LVH) was defined by left ventricular mass indexed for Body Surface Area (LVM/BSA) or for height (LVM/height). Electrocardiographic LVH (ECG-LVH) was defined by Sokolow-Lyon (SL), Cornell and Cornell Product (CP) criteria. ECHO-LVH was defined by LVM/BSA≥125 g/m in male or ≥110 g/m in female (LVH1); LVM/BSA≥115 g/m in male, or ≥95 g/m in female (LVH2) and LVM/height ≥51 g/m in male or ≥47 g/m in female (LVH3).

RESULTS

As compared with SL and Cornell criteria, CP had the greatest correlation coefficient in the association with echocardiography-defined LVH, except for LVM/BSA in men. Of note, CP criterion had the greatest area under curve of ROC than Cornell criterion and the SL index, not only in total population but also in subgroups classified by blood pressure.

CONCLUSION

In ECG-LVH criteria, CP criterion complies better than SL index and Cornell criterion in assessing cardiac hypertrophy.

摘要

背景

左心室肥厚(LVH)是高血压靶器官损害(TOD)的临床前表现之一。然而,目前尚不清楚哪种心电图标准在诊断 LVH 方面表现更好。

目的

研究心电图(ECG)诊断的 LVH 与超声心动图(ECHO)的一致性。以 ECHO 诊断的 LVH 为参考,比较三种不同的心电图标准(Sokolow-Lyon、Cornell 和 Cornell 乘积标准),并找到用于识别社区中中国老年人心血管肥大的最佳心电图指标。

患者和方法

对位于上海北部社区的 1789 名年龄 >65 岁的老年人进行了超声心动图和心电图检查,以确定 LVH。超声心动图 LVH(ECHO-LVH)通过左心室质量指数(LVMI)/体表面积(BSA)或身高(LVMI/身高)来定义。心电图 LVH(ECG-LVH)通过 Sokolow-Lyon(SL)、Cornell 和 Cornell 乘积(CP)标准来定义。ECHO-LVH 通过男性的 LVM/BSA≥125 g/m2 或女性的 LVM/BSA≥110 g/m2(LVH1);男性的 LVM/BSA≥115 g/m2,或女性的 LVM/BSA≥95 g/m2(LVH2)和男性的 LVM/身高≥51 g/m2 或女性的 LVM/身高≥47 g/m2(LVH3)来定义。

结果

与 SL 和 Cornell 标准相比,CP 标准与超声心动图定义的 LVH 的相关性系数最大,除了男性的 LVM/BSA。值得注意的是,CP 标准的 ROC 曲线下面积大于 Cornell 标准和 SL 指数,不仅在总人群中,而且在按血压分类的亚组中。

结论

在心电图 LVH 标准中,CP 标准在评估心脏肥大方面比 SL 指数和 Cornell 标准更符合。
